Water stress buildup is triggered when groundwater is not drained from behind the seawall. Groundwater against a seawall can be from the area's natural water-table, rainfall percolating into the ground behind the wall surface and waves overtopping the wall. The groundwater level can additionally rise throughout durations of high water (high tide).

A seawall, made of rocks in Paravur near Kollam city in India. Seawall construction has existed since ancient times. In the very first century BCE, Romans developed a seawall or breakwater at Caesarea Maritima producing a fabricated harbor (Sebastos Harbor). The building made use of Pozzolana concrete which hardens in contact with salt water.
They were floated right into position and sunk. The resulting harbor/breakwater/seawall is still in presence today even more than 2000 years later.

However, the previous French colonial enclave of Pondicherry got away unharmed. This was mainly because of French designers who had constructed (and preserved) a massive rock seawall while when the city was a French colony. This 300-year-old seawall successfully kept Pondicherry's historical center completely dry although tidal wave waves drove water 24 ft (7.3 m) above the regular high-tide mark.

During the 2011 Thoku quake and tidal wave, the seawalls in a lot of areas were overwhelmed. In Kamaishi. affordable bulkhead, 4-metre (13 feet) waves surmounted the seawall the world's largest, set up a few years ago in the city's harbor at a deepness of 63 m (207 ft), a length of 2 kilometres (1.2 mi) and a cost of $1.5 billion and at some point immersed the city.

Probably, the added defense supplied by the seawalls provided an additional margin of time for citizens to evacuate and additionally quit some of the complete pressure of energy which would certainly have triggered the wave to climb higher in the backs of seaside valleys. The failing of the world's biggest seawall, which cost $1.5 billion to create, shows that building more powerful seawalls to safeguard larger areas would have been even less economical.
Fundamentally, the destruction in coastal areas and a final casualty predicted to exceed 10,000 could push Japan to redesign its seawalls or think about more reliable alternative methods of seaside protection for severe events. Such hardened coasts can likewise supply a false sense of safety to homeowner and local homeowners as obvious in this scenario.
